What is a part time Amazon FBA assistant?

A Part Time Amazon FBA Assistant is someone who helps Amazon sellers manage their Fulfillment by Amazon (FBA) business on a part-time basis. Their responsibilities often include product research, listing optimization, inventory management, order tracking, customer service, and competitor analysis. Working part-time allows these assistants to support multiple sellers or balance other commitments, while still helping businesses grow on Amazon. This role is ideal for individuals with knowledge of e-commerce platforms, data entry, and online marketing.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time Amazon FBA assistant?

To thrive as a Part Time Amazon FBA Assistant, you need a solid understanding of e-commerce operations, inventory management, and basic data analysis, often supported by experience with online marketplaces. Familiarity with Amazon Seller Central, spreadsheet software, and tools like Helium 10 or Jungle Scout is typically required. Str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and effective communication help you manage tasks and coordinate with sellers or suppliers. These skills are crucial for ensuring smooth store operations, accurate inventory tracking, and optimized product listings in a competitive online market.

How does a part time Amazon FBA assistant typically interact with other team members or departments?

As a Part Time Amazon FBA Assistant, you will often collaborate closely with inventory managers, customer service representatives, and sometimes marketing teams. Communication is typically managed through project management tools or regular check-in meetings to ensure product listings, inventory levels, and shipments are accurately handled. You may also need to liaise with suppliers or logistics partners to coordinate restocking and resolve issues. Teamwork and clear communication are essential, as your contributions help maintain smooth operations and positive customer experiences.

What is the difference between Part Time Amazon Fba Assistant vs Part Time Amazon Product Listing Specialist?

AspectPart Time Amazon Fba AssistantPart Time Amazon Product Listing Specialist
CredentialsBasic e-commerce knowledge, familiarity with Amazon toolsExperience with product listings, keyword research, and listing optimization
Work EnvironmentRemote, flexible hours, supporting FBA operationsRemote, focused on creating and managing product listings
Employer & Industry UsageAmazon sellers, e-commerce businessesAmazon sellers, e-commerce companies
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

The Part Time Amazon Fba Assistant typically handles inventory management, order processing, and FBA logistics, requiring general Amazon platform knowledge. In contrast, the Part Time Amazon Product Listing Specialist focuses on creating, optimizing, and managing product listings to improve sales. Both roles support Amazon sellers but differ in specific responsibilities and skill sets.
